Kivalliq Energy Corporation (TSX VENTURE:KIV) (the "Company" or "Kivalliq")
today announced a two phase 2013 exploration program at the 340,000 acre Angilak
Property in Nunavut Territory, Canada. The plan for 2013 will build upon the Lac
50 Trend inferred resource, currently at 2,831,000 tonnes grading 0.69% U3O8 and
totalling 43.3Mlbs U3O8(i).


Drilling will expand the current resource, advance additional high-priority
uranium targets within the Lac 50 Trend, and test select property-wide targets.
Kivalliq intends to drill 25,000 metres of NQ core with three diamond drill rigs
and 3,000 metres of reverse circulation ("RC") drilling on exploration targets
with a light-weight RC fly rig. Extensive ground based geophysical surveying,
prospecting, and soil sampling campaigns are also planned. 


The following summarizes both the first and second phases of the proposed 2013
exploration campaign: 




--  25,000 metres of diamond drill core focused on expanding the Lac 50
    Trend resource, testing new zones along strike and parallel to the
    resource and investigating the high priority Dipole and VGR targets. 
--  3,000 metres of RC drilling to advance multiple untested conductors
    along strike and parallel to the Lac 50 Trend resource 
--  Ground geophysical surveys consisting of magnetics, electromagnetics,
    radiometrics and gravity 
--  Continued mapping and prospecting to advance priority target areas
    defined by the 2012 program and identify new targets on a property wide
    scale 
--  Ongoing geological modeling, metallurgical testing, and environmental
    studies 
--  Continued emphasis on community consultation 
--  Engineering studies focused on camp and infrastructure expansion to
    optimize project logistics. 
--  Update the current Lac 50 Trend Inferred Resource Estimate by the end of
    Q1 2014. 
--  Initiate a Preliminary Economic Assessment scheduled to be completed in
    2014



"Based on the positive momentum from the 2012 season, and a 300% increase to the
Lac 50 Trend resource over the past two seasons, Kivalliq's board of directors
has approved an aggressive exploration strategy at the Angilak Property in
2013," stated Jim Paterson, Kivalliq's CEO. "While maintaining our high
standards of environmental stewardship and cost effective exploration, our 2013
exploration goals are clearly defined as follows: increase the inferred resource
base in the Lac 50 Trend by drilling high priority and untested conductors near
the current inferred resource; demonstrate Angilak's district scale potential by
testing unconformity style targets elsewhere on the property; and initiate a
Preliminary Economic Assessment scheduled for completion in 2014." 


Kivalliq's board of directors has approved a two-phased, $15.5 million
exploration program at Angilak for the 2013 season. The first phase, budgeted at
$8 million, will commence on February 21, 2013 with the mobilization of crews
and equipment to the existing Nutaaq camp. The Company plans to drill from April
to June using two diamond drill rigs and one RC rig. Ground geophysical
surveying will run concurrently with the drill program until break-up sometime
in June. Pending results and market conditions, the Company will commence the
second phase of the proposed exploration program at Angilak in June, with
continued core and RC drilling and geophysical, geological, geochemical and
engineering surveys in the field.

About Kivalliq Energy Corporation  

Kivalliq Energy Corporation (TSX VENTURE:KIV) is a Vancouver-based uranium
exploration company holding Canada's highest grade uranium deposit outside of
Saskatchewan's Athabasca Basin. Its flagship project, the 340,268 acre Angilak
Property in Nunavut Territory, hosts the Lac 50 Trend with a NI 43-101 Inferred
Resource of 2,831,000 tonnes grading 0.69% U3O8, totaling 43.3 million pounds
U3O8, at a 0.2% cut-off grade. Kivalliq's comprehensive exploration programs
continue to advance the Lac 50 Trend and demonstrate the "District Scale"
potential of the Angilak Property.


Kivalliq's team of northern exploration specialists have forged strong
relationships with sophisticated resource sector investors and project partner
Nunavut Tunngavik Inc. ("NTI") in order to advance the Angilak Property.
Kivalliq was the first company to sign a comprehensive agreement to explore for
uranium on Inuit Owned Lands in Nunavut Territory, Canada and is committed to
building shareholder value while adhering to high levels of environmental and
safety standards and proactive local community engagement.

Cautionary Note concerning estimates of Inferred Resources:

This news release uses the term "inferred resources". Inferred resources have a
great amount of uncertainty as to their existence, and great uncertainty as to
their economic and legal feasibility. It cannot be assumed that all or any part
of an Inferred Mineral Resource will ever be upgraded to a higher category.
Kivalliq advises U.S. investors that while this term is recognized and required
by Canadian regulations,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ission does not
recognize it. U.S. investors are cautioned not to assume that part or all of an
inferred resource exists, or is economically or legally mineable.
